Ok, i can run with that. Lets say that generators needed parts to be completed. Maps could say have at least one vehicle somewhere to rob spark plugs from or something like that. Other parts could be found say in the basement or even just scattered around like totems, not impossible to find but not glaringly obvious nor always in the same spot. And the "repair" phase would be installing these parts. Maybe a jerry can would need to be found and brought to the gens, and the running action is blocked while carrying for the first 3 gens because gas is heavy.
Further more maybe certian tools could be found like a ratchet or funnel to speed up these actions, but there would only be one of each a game.

do this number: No walking while carrying gas, the survivors have to get gas canisters from white chests.
There are 3 white chests per map with equal distance between them.
A survivor can drop the gas canister (but obviously dropping items takes long so you would need to pre drop it before you get caught)
The killer and survivor can both see a dropped canisters aura.
The killer can break the canister: resulting in the survivors having to go all the way back to the box.
Gasoline would be required after a gen is completed.
Gens would only be 60 charges.
Once a gen is repaired it cannot be regressed and the killer would have to instead worry about the gas.
